Analysis

Algeria recorded 209.51 2010 = 100 for consumer price index in 2025. That is the highest value across all 57 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.4% on the previous year and up 65.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, consumer price index in Algeria peaked at 209.51 2010 = 100 in 2025 and was at its lowest, 2.57 2010 = 100, in 1969.

Algeria ranks 55th of 189 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The CPI shows the average price level of goods and services purchased by consumers. This is expressed relative to a base year – in this case 2010. For example, a CPI of 120 means that prices were 20% higher than in 2010.
